The use of crystallized … WebMay 13, 2014 · What is a crystallized risk? It is when the risk actually becomes an event. For example, there is a risk of fraud. The crystalisiation of that risk of fraud is when the actual fraud happens.

Within the limitations of the Lifetime Allowance, 25% of the UFPLS will be paid tax free, with the balance taxed as pension income at the point of withdrawal. Key points

WebMar 15, 2024 · Originally, there were nine separate benefit crystallisation events (BCEs) defined in the legislation, but they’ve been added to over the years as the rules have … WebMar 15, 2024 · Currently, there are 13 benefit crystallisation events. Jessicca List, pension technical manager at Curtis Banks, gives a brief introduction to each. Originally, there were nine separate benefit crystallisation events (BCEs) defined in the legislation, but they’ve been added to over the years as the rules have changed.
